The Benefits Of Eloping At a Bed & Breakfast

It’s no secret that some couple’s desires don’t involve spending thousands of dollars & spending more than a year (or two) planning an event. However, what most people don’t realize is that the word “elopement” doesn’t always mean running away into the mountains and getting married in secret – although sometimes it definitely does and hey there I’d love to join you!

An elopement is simply an small intimate ceremony of maybe a couple witnesses and your immediate family. It’s a choice to forgo the large traditional affairs and get married literally anywhere. In this case, it was a bed & breakfast on a quiet street in downtown Kingston. 

So why should you also consider a B&B for your day – I’ve got a few pros for you!

  1. Accommodations available the night before and/or the night after! This one is obvious, but if you get married at a Bed & Breakfast you also get to enjoy the perks of spending the night there! Not to mention that the getting ready pictures in your cute (& well decorated) room is a plus! If you plan well enough in advance you may be able to rent out additional rooms for your guests as well!

  2. On site catering! You probably already know this as well but the second B standing for “Breakfast” is not just there for show! For Jacob & Paloma’s morning wedding, the Inn prepared a lovely high tea experience for them & their family  to enjoy privately in their dining room. 

  3. Location & aesthetics. B&B’s are known for their beautiful locations, landscaping, decor and overall charm. Whether it’s a cozy fireplace, a colourful garden arch or stunning stained glass window seats, the photos are going to be stunning!

A look Into The Secret Garden Inn In Kingston Ontario

Bed & Breakfasts have built a reputation over the years to have excellent hospitality, delicious food, and a cosy atmosphere. The Secret Garden Inn in Kingston, ON delivered on all fronts!

The Room: J&P luckily were able to snag  the last room in the B&B when they inquired about hosting their elopement at the Inn. We had time to capture a few moments of them getting ready together before they had to check out and I’m obsessed with the cozy vibes.

The Terrace & Garden: Before the guests arrived, we explored around the Secret Garden for a few fun couples  portraits to work off those “before the ceremony” nerves. The porch swing was probably my favourite touch, I could have hung out there all day reading a good book. 

The Ceremony: Jacob & Paloma hosted their ceremony in the cozy sitting room in front of these stunning glass windows. The staff were so accommodating to make sure the chairs were set up the way they wanted and ensured the space was private. The antique furniture also added a nice touch to all the photos!

The Dining Room: Following the ceremony, the family was invited to join J&P for their high tea experience in the attached dining room – I’m still thinking about that chicken salad. The food was incredible & they even had gluten free & dairy free options available!

The beauty about getting married or eloping at a Bed & Breakfast is that the options truly are endless! These days there are so many available B&B’s with their own unique style & charm, so I would encourage you to check out all your local (or destination) options to find one that best suits you.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Are pets allowed?

A: At the Secret Garden Inn they do not welcome any pets, but I would encourage you to check with others because some B&B’s do accommodate!

Q: Are you able to book out the whole property for a private event?

A: This may require more planning in advance to be able to book out the whole place without there being any previous bookings, but in most cases this is possible yes!
